**About the Role**
As the Reconciliation Officer the primary purpose of this position is to reconcile and investigate outstanding items in the bank’s General Ledger and suspense accounts as well as preparing settlement and reconciliations for the group’s payment clearing streams.

Day to day you will responsible for reconciling, investigating and reviewing reconciliations relating to BOQ branch operations and involves the preparation of general ledger vouchers and journals.

The role is also responsible for the preparation of reconciliations relating to various areas of BOQ Group, including but not limited to myBOQ, VMA (Virgin Money Australia), BOQ Specialist, BOQ Finance, Treasury, Banking Operations and Financial Accounting.

Key responsibilities include:

- The daily balancing of settlements between BOQ Group and Other Financial Institutions
- The daily and monthly reconciliation of the group’s various General Ledger and suspense accounts across BOQ Group, BOQ Finance, VMA and BOQ Specialist
- The reconciliation and review of the branch network’s daily summary of business
- Ability to identify and resolve general ledger related issues on a timely basis
- To review suspense account activity performed by the branch network and head office within a structured task rotation setting so as to isolate and correct any irregularities which may have occurred
- The investigation of errors relating to balancing and remediation of these errors through quality communication
- Liaising with internal teams and stakeholders to resolve issues and improve inefficient or outdated processes in line with group strategy and internal policy
